在日常办公和数据分析工作中,Excel作为一款强大的工具,其内置函数库为用户提供了丰富的功能支持。其中,INDEX函数是Excel中的一个重要函数,它能够根据给定的行列索引值返回相应位置的数据,具有广泛的应用场景。本文将详细介绍INDEX函数的基本语法、使用方法及其在实际工作中的应用实例。
首先,让我们了解INDEX函数的基本结构。INDEX函数的语法形式为:INDEX(array,row_num,[column_num])。其中,“array”表示需要从中提取数据的单元格区域;“row_num”指定所要提取数据所在的行号;“column_num”则用于确定列号(可选参数)。当省略“column_num”时,默认取第一列进行操作。
接下来,我们通过几个具体的例子来展示如何运用INDEX函数解决问题:
例一:基本用法
假设有一张销售记录表,A1:D5是商品信息区域。如果想要查找B3单元格对应的商品名称,可以使用公式=INDEX(A1:A5,ROW(B3)-ROW(A1)+1)。这里ROW函数用于计算相对行数,确保即使数据位置发生变化,也能准确找到目标值。
例二:结合MATCH函数实现动态查找
有时候我们需要根据条件查找特定的数据。例如,在上述销售记录表中,若想根据输入的关键字自动定位到对应的行号并显示该行的所有信息,则可以采用组合公式=INDEX(A1:D5,MATCH("关键字",B1:B5,0),0)。其中,MATCH函数负责确定匹配项的位置,而INDEX函数则据此提取整行的数据。
此外,INDEX函数还可以与其他高级功能配合使用,如数组公式或VBA脚本,以实现更复杂的逻辑处理。比如,在处理大量数据时,可以通过编写自定义函数来优化性能,提高工作效率。
总之,掌握好INDEX函数不仅有助于简化日常工作流程,还能显著提升数据分析能力。希望本文提供的指南能帮助读者更好地理解和利用这一实用工具,在实践中发挥出更大的价值。当然,实际应用中还需结合具体需求灵活调整公式设置,不断探索更多可能性。